Module Overview
Name: Disable-SecuritySettings
Module: powershell/management/mailraider/disable_security
Source code [1]: empire/server/modules/powershell/management/mailraider/disable_security.yaml
Source code [2]: empire/server/modules/powershell/management/mailraider/disable_security.py
MITRE ATT&CK:
T1047
Language: PowerShell
Needs admin: No
OPSEC safe: Yes
Background: Yes
The disable_security module checks for the ObjectModelGuard, PromptOOMSend, and AdminSecurityMode registry keys for Outlook security. This function must be run in an administrative context in order to set the values for the registry keys.

Required Module Options
This is a list of options that are required by the disable_security module:
Agent
Agent to run module on.
Version
The version of Microsoft Outlook.
Additional Module Options
This is a list of additional options that are supported by the disable_security module:
AdminPassword
Optional AdminPassword credentials to use for registry changes.
AdminUser
Optional AdminUser credentials to use for registry changes.
OutputFunction
PowerShell's output function to use ("Out-String", "ConvertTo-Json", "ConvertTo-Csv", "ConvertTo-Html", "ConvertTo-Xml").
Default value: Out-String
.
Suggested values: Out-String
, ConvertTo-Json
, ConvertTo-Csv
, ConvertTo-Html
, ConvertTo-Xml
.
Reset
Switch. Reset security settings to default values.
